To solve routine and non-routine problems using data presented in a pie graph, you may follow the 4-step plan. 1. Understand – Know what is asked in the problem. 2. Plan – What operation to be used in the problem and its equation. 3. Solve – Show your solutions. 4. Check and Look back – Check and review your answer. Complete your
